Synchronize data

In the
Sync
main view, you can see the different
synchronization profiles and the kind of data to
be synchronized.
1 Select a synchronization profile and
Synchronize. The status of the synchronization is
shown at the bottom of the screen.
To cancel synchronization before it finishes,
select Cancel.
2 You are notified when the synchronization is complete.
After synchronization is complete, select
View log
to open a log file showing the synchronization
status
(Complete
or Incomplete) and how many
calendar or contact entries have been added, updated,
deleted, or discarded (not synchronized) in the phone
or on the server.
